The difficulties in finding manpower and the impact of the weather conditions have been the characteristics that have defined this year’s harvest in La Rioja.
These conclusions are those made evident at the meeting of the Committee on Migratory Flows, which was chaired this morning by the Government delegate in La Rioja, Beatriz Arraiz Nalda, and in which the Central Executive participated the Inspection of Labour and Social Security (ITSS), SEPE, Labour and Immigration, Social Security and Agriculture. You have also attended the Government of La Rioja, Municipality of Logroño, agricultural unions, FER, Association of Family Wineries, Riojana Federation of Municipalities and social entities.
During the evaluation meeting, it became clear that the pilot experience that has been implemented in this campaign to control identity theft has been very positive. Specifically, for the first time, ITSS, the National Police and the Civil Guard have been on the spot in the same operation with computer systems that have made it possible to check in situ both the identities and the highs in Social Security, which has allowed immediate action in non-regular cases.
For this reason, it has been announced that in future campaigns, this operation will continue, allowing us to act in the same field.
In addition, and in accordance with the new Regulation on Foreigners that was approved on November 20 and will enter into force in May, Arraiz Nalda has announced that the Government Delegation in La Roja and the Labor and Immigration Unit will hold an information day aimed at the third sector, trade unions and RES and in which the new conditions will be explained that reduce deadlines and procedures, eliminate duplication, reinforce the rights of migrant workers and provide guarantees to companies.
Finally, and according to the data of the Ministry of Labor, in La Rioja more than 13,800 contracts were registered in the harvest campaign - August, September and October - in the economic activity of Agriculture and 13,730 highs in Social Security.
